
Disparadores principales
Utiliza el bloque Start para todo lo que se origina desde el editor, despliegue a API o experiencias de despliegue a chat. Otros disparadores siguen disponibles para flujos de trabajo basados en eventos:
Start
Punto de entrada unificado que admite ejecuciones del editor, despliegues de API y despliegues de chat
Webhook
Recibe cargas útiles de webhooks externos
Schedule
Ejecución basada en cron o intervalos
RSS Feed
Monitorea feeds RSS y Atom para nuevo contenido
Comparación rápida
| Disparador | Condición de inicio |
|---|---|
| Start | Ejecuciones del editor, solicitudes de despliegue a API o mensajes de chat |
| Schedule | Temporizador gestionado en el bloque de programación |
| Webhook | Al recibir una solicitud HTTP entrante |
| RSS Feed | Nuevo elemento publicado en el feed |
El bloque Start siempre expone los campos
input,conversationIdyfiles. Añade campos personalizados al formato de entrada para datos estructurados adicionales.
Uso de disparadores
- Coloca el bloque Start en la ranura de inicio (o un disparador alternativo como Webhook/Schedule).
- Configura cualquier esquema o autenticación requerida.
- Conecta el bloque al resto del flujo de trabajo.
Los despliegues alimentan cada disparador. Actualiza el flujo de trabajo, vuelve a desplegarlo, y todos los puntos de entrada de los disparadores recogen la nueva instantánea. Aprende más en Ejecución → Instantáneas de despliegue.
Prioridad de ejecución manual
Cuando haces clic en Ejecutar en el editor, Sim selecciona automáticamente qué disparador ejecutar según el siguiente orden de prioridad:
- Bloque Start (prioridad más alta)
- Disparadores de programación
- Disparadores externos (webhooks, integraciones como Slack, Gmail, Airtable, etc.)
Si tu flujo de trabajo tiene múltiples disparadores, se ejecutará el disparador de mayor prioridad. Por ejemplo, si tienes tanto un bloque Start como un disparador Webhook, al hacer clic en Ejecutar se ejecutará el bloque Start.
Disparadores externos con cargas útiles simuladas: Cuando los disparadores externos (webhooks e integraciones) se ejecutan manualmente, Sim genera automáticamente cargas útiles simuladas basadas en la estructura de datos esperada del disparador. Esto asegura que los bloques posteriores puedan resolver las variables correctamente durante las pruebas.